CVE-2019-11708

Exp

Insufficient vetting of parameters passed with the Prompt:Open IPC message between child and parent processes can result in the non-sandboxed parent process opening web content chosen by a compromised child process. When combined with additional vulnerabilities this could result in executing arbitrary code on the user's computer. This vulnerability affects Firefox ESR < 60.7.2, Firefox < 67.0.4, and Thunderbird < 60.7.2.

CISA KEV Record for CVE-2019-11708

Name: Mozilla Firefox and Thunderbird Sandbox Escape Vulnerability · CISA KEV detail

Exploit added: 2022-05-23

Action due: 2022-06-13

Required action: Apply updates per vendor instructions.
